Hi everyone
,
I’m Kushal Shukla, a passionate software engineer focusing on Go backend development, DevOps, and cloud-native systems. I love building scalable, reproducible backend infrastructures and contributing to open-source projects that push the limits of performance and reliability.
My Background
Latest role: Golang Backend Developer at Swif.AI (YC-backed startup)
- Integrated Wazuh with Elasticsearch to fetch and display real-time vulnerability and alert data.
- Built multiple policy management APIs and agent-side Golang code to automate endpoint security configurations.
- Worked with Docker, Kubernetes, and GitHub Actions to ensure CI/CD reliability and system consistency.
Previous:
- LFX Mentorship (CNCF / Prometheus): Contributed to Prometheus’ test infrastructure and benchmarking suite, optimizing query logic, automation, and data handling for large-scale performance testing.
- Strategic Future AI: Built a full-stack Kanban board system with React, Node.js, and Kubernetes featuring Stripe integration, real-time updates, and JWT-based authentication.
Tech Stack
Languages: Go, C++, Bash
DevOps: Docker, Kubernetes, Prometheus, Grafana, GitHub Actions, Terraform, AWS
Backend: REST APIs, gRPC, Fiber, PostgreSQL, MongoDB
Focus Areas: Distributed systems, observability, CI/CD automation, backend reliability
Open Source Contributions
During my CNCF mentorship, I contributed several PRs to the Prometheus ecosystem that improved benchmarking automation and CI/CD workflows:
- Create a CLI for uploading and downloading blocks by kushalShukla-web · Pull Request #760 · prometheus/test-infra · GitHub
- Promtool Update: JUnit-Format XML Test Result Support by kushalShukla-web · Pull Request #14506 · prometheus/prometheus · GitHub
- Integrating block-sync in an init-container by kushalShukla-web · Pull Request #779 · prometheus/test-infra · GitHub
- Enhance Load Generator to Query Pre-Generated Data Blocks by kushalShukla-web · Pull Request #782 · prometheus/test-infra · GitHub
- Add remote-write to Prombench by kushalShukla-web · Pull Request #787 · prometheus/test-infra · GitHub
- Add additional PromQL operators to synthetic load by kushalShukla-web · Pull Request #747 · prometheus/test-infra · GitHub
These contributions focused on performance benchmarking, data transfer tooling, and test infrastructure improvements using Go, Docker, and Kubernetes.
Availability
I’m open to remote opportunities and collaborations in areas like backend systems, observability tooling, or cloud-native Go projects.
Contact
Email: kushalshukla110@gmail.com
GitHub: kushalshukla · GitHub
LinkedIn: Kushal Shukla - Aviva Canada | LinkedIn